What happened at each round

Step-up, pace versus the sector's normal cadence, and revenue/exemption moves — read straight from the reported round facts reported.

  1. Seed$1.8M2015-06-04
    • First recorded raise — entered as Seed.
    • 24 investors on this round.
  2. Series A$11.0M2018-01-17
    • Raised again after 31 mo — slower than the ~13 mo sector norm.
    • Round 6.1× larger than the prior — scaling up.
    • 41 investors on this round.
  3. Series A$6.2M2019-08-02
    • Raised 18 mo later, in step with the ~13 mo sector norm.
    • Round 1.8× smaller than the prior — bridge or down round.
    • 22 investors on this round.
  4. Series B$17.7M2021-05-18
    • Raised again after 22 mo — slower than the ~13 mo sector norm.
    • Round 2.8× larger than the prior — scaling up.
    • 23 investors on this round.
  5. Series C$86.6M2022-12-20
    • Raised 19 mo later, in step with the ~13 mo sector norm.
    • Round 4.9× larger than the prior — scaling up.
    • 9 investors on this round.
  6. Series C$47.0M2024-03-21
    • Raised 15 mo later, in step with the ~13 mo sector norm.
    • Round 1.8× smaller than the prior — bridge or down round.
    • 3 investors on this round.
  7. Series C$4.2M2025-07-21
    • Raised 16 mo later, in step with the ~13 mo sector norm.
    • Round 11.1× smaller than the prior — bridge or down round.
    • 7 investors on this round.
